Popular articles

What is over-engineering software engineering?

What is over-engineering software engineering?

Over-engineering is simply creating a product with greater functionality, quality, generality, extensibility, documentation, or any other aspect than is required.

How much do programmers actually code?

In conclusion, we can say that most of the programmers actually work between 2-4 hours per day. Of course, there are some that work more, but they are less common. I hope that I have helped you with this article.

What to look for when hiring a software engineer?

There is no right or wrong answer to this question, as it all depends on what you are looking for in a software engineer. You may want an engineer who will work hard and who can be independent. On the flip side, you may want someone who is a team player and is not stubborn about doing things their way. 14. What Are Your Career Goals?

READ:   Which is better MongoDB or Django?

Do software engineers make mistakes?

Every software engineer who is passionate about engineering and has worked on personal and business projects will have made some mistakes. Perhaps they worked on a project that ended up failing. That is not a bad thing, however, as it allows them to learn important lessons from those failures.

Why do software engineers make estimates that are off the Mark?

Software engineers often come up with estimates that are entirely off the mark. Although they may want to think that they can deliver an end result within a specific time frame, new issues and bugs often come up that causes them to be late on their estimate.

How many interview questions should you ask a software engineer?

Therefore, you should know the best questions to ask during the hiring process to successfully recruit software engineers. These 17 interview questions for software engineers are some of the top questions you should ask potential software engineering candidates that you’re interviewing. 1. Why Did You Decide to Become a Software Engineer?